在單一終端機視窗中捕捉啟動 a.out 3 次的命令,每次作為後台作業執行

在單一終端機視窗中捕捉啟動 a.out 3 次的命令,每次作為後台作業執行

在Linux終端機視窗上,有沒有一種方法可以啟動像./a.out這樣的程式3次,每次作為後台作業運行。有人告訴我 IO 重定向很有幫助。

答案1

您可以在命令後面使用與號 ( &) 將其置於背景。如果您希望它的 3 個實例在背景運行,您可以執行以下操作:

./a.out& ./a.out& ./a.out&

請注意,它不必立即執行該命令,以下命令也會執行相同的操作:

./a.out & ./a.out & ./a.out &

然後您應該會看到類似以下內容(取決於您的 Linux 風格/shell):

[1] 19731
[2] 27320
[3] 12461

這些是您啟動的程式的各個執行個體的 PID。

希望有幫助。

相關內容